Northwood was not able to break out of their rough patch on Wednesday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They came up short against the Carey Blue Devils, falling 3-0. The result was an unpleasant reminder to the Rangers of the 3-0 loss they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in October of 2019.
The match finished with set scores of 25-13, 25-12, 25-13.
Gabby Summit was the offensive standout of the contest as she had 15 digs and two aces. She is on a roll when it comes to digs, as she's now had ten or more in the last three games she's played dating back to last season.
Northwood's defeat dropped their record down to 2-17. As for Carey, they have been performing well recently as they've won six of their last eight games, which provided a nice bump to their 16-7 record this season.
Northwood does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for Carey, they will challenge Western Reserve at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
